Transaction 900333136061be1432546269636b85e5d8a7325132959af845e16866106021cb
1 Input
1 Output
-
900333136061be1432546269636b85e5d8a7325132959af845e16866106021cb:0
- value
- 11150900
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 96cae890468999e54c668e0bf710c8b53475dfd6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EkKS6rXv9n6tfLskerSyTbFFVpnWwQSpe